About White Signal, NM

White Signal is a small community located in New Mexico with a population of 200 residents according to the latest US Census Bureau American Community Survey data. The median household income is $92,500 per year, which is 23% above the national median of $75,149. The median age of 77 years is notably older the US median age of 38.9 years, suggesting a more established community with a higher proportion of long-term residents.

Housing Market Overview

The housing market in White Signal features a median home value of $250,000, which is 2% above the national median of $244,900. This positions White Signal in a moderately priced market relative to the rest of the country. Median monthly rent is $0, 100% below the national average of $1,163/month. Of the 108 total housing units, 100% are owner-occupied (108 units) and 0% are renter-occupied (0 units). The high homeownership rate suggests a stable, established residential community.
